  • SummaryCaption: "Santa makes a big hit--A feast, movies and gifts from Santa made a happy day for 250 orphans from St. Joseph's Hall and Kallman Home for Children at party staged by Brooklyn Exchange Club. Shown with youngsters are Joseph F. Toomey, president of the club, and C. K. Van Demark, who played Santa."
